Output 152305f68f6cd6bf499d156f9eb570f1aa6a40df7de6771de423f31746773a30:19

value
340653
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43d9071f10fe420e9eeabd4e8eab5204fe8e6f4b OP_EQUALVERIFY OP_CHECKSIG
address
17BkGDAgxX2G5dZ29F7qtfDp7fqr5VFxei
transaction
152305f68f6cd6bf499d156f9eb570f1aa6a40df7de6771de423f31746773a30
spent
true